About Trace Adkins at Thrasher-Horne Center for the Arts
Adkins is known for his song Every Light in the House which was a major hit in 1997. Working together with Lambert on Bad for Boyfriend in 2014 highlights his ability to mix styles. Trace was engaged in a serious motorcycle accident in 2001, which called for reconstructive surgery on his face. Curiously, Adkins has worked together with several songwriters, including the renowned Nashville songwriter, Jeffrey Steele, to craft memorable hits. Securing multiple music awards underscores his popularity with fans; interestingly, he has made appearances on various talk shows, including The Ellen DeGeneres Show, where he shared stories about his experiences and career.
